VIDEO: Police seek help to identify ATM skimming suspects
TAMPA (FOX 13) - Tampa police have asked for the public's help in identifying two suspects who placed a skimming device on an ATM last week.
On Tuesday, the Tampa Police Department posted the surveillance video on their Facebook page, which shows the two suspects inside the 7-11 store on N. Nebraska Avenue.
According to police, "the suspect who installed the skimmer is seen wearing a black shirt, black pants, and black shoes. The second suspect acted as a lookout."
The second suspect was wearing a white shirt and dark-colored shorts.
In the Facebook post, police urge the public to call Crime Stoppers if they have any information.
